When considering plastic lid machines for manufacturing, several key features stand out. Efficiency is crucial. Look for machines that offer high production rates without sacrificing quality. Fast cycle times can significantly boost output. Precision in forming lids is also essential. Ensure the machine can handle varying thicknesses and materials effectively.
Durability matters too. A robust machine can withstand the rigors of continuous use. Easy maintenance is another factor. Machines with simple components reduce downtime. Operators appreciate user-friendly interfaces that streamline the production process.
The Disposable Plastic Cup Lid Thermoforming Machine is one area to explore. It should have adaptable settings for different lid designs. Flexibility in the production line can prevent bottlenecks. While investing in advanced features is beneficial, it's important to assess long-term value. Sometimes, machines with fewer bells and whistles perform better in the long run. The true advancement in plastic manufacturing lies in the power of innovative machinery, such as the cutting-edge pressure thermoforming machines designed to maximize efficiency. A prime example of this technology is a four-station large PP plastic thermoforming machine, which seamlessly integrates forming, cutting, and stacking processes into a single operational line. This streamlined approach not only enhances production capabilities but also addresses the pressing demands of the industry for higher output and reduced operational complexities.
Equipped with servo motor drives, this machinery ensures stable operation and low noise levels, which significantly improves the working environment. The high efficiency of the thermoforming machine allows manufacturers to produce various plastic products, including trays, containers, boxes, and lids, with precision and speed.
